It is not always as easy as 'it should stay up forever'.
When I look at sites to decide if there is a trade to be done, I expect the sites to remain somewhat active and current. If I check a link 3-6-12-18 months later and its now a link farm, or blatant splog that has been left for dead, I'm dropping the trade, I email and explain that I'm simply not feeding their shit piles, and to hit me up for a real, equal value trade. I've dumped 40-50 trades probably this year already, and only really done one full review, but also have thousands of such trades done. |
